Gonzo’s Quest Megaways game: An Icon Reinvented
Gonzo’s Quest Megaways stands on the shoulders of a giant. The original game revolutionized slot gaming when it arrived, swapping spinning reels for tumbling stone blocks. The ‘Avalanche’ feature felt different. Now, Big Time Gaming’s Megaways engine has thrown petrol on that fire. It randomizes how many symbols appear on each reel, providing up to 117,649 possible ways to win on a single spin. That classic cascade mechanic now has unpredictable and exciting potential. Every tumble can start a chain of wins, making even a short play session a thrilling experience. For a trivia break, that intensity is exactly the point.

FAQ
What is the Gonzo’s Quest Megaways slot?
It is an online slot from NetEnt that uses Big Time Gaming’s Megaways system. It reinterprets the classic Gonzo’s Quest, incorporating cascading reels, up to 117,649 ways to win, and a Free Falls bonus with climbing multipliers. The story still follows Gonzo on his quest for the lost city of El Dorado.
Is it possible to play Gonzo’s Quest Megaways for free in Australia?
Certainly. Most licensed international casinos that welcome Australian players provide a free demo version. You can access all the features and bonuses without placing a real bet. This is the ideal way to test the game during a trivia night pause.

How exactly does the Megaways mechanic work in this game?
Megaways varies the number of symbols on each reel every spin. This creates a different number of potential winning lines each time, maxing out at 117,649. Paired with the Avalanche cascade, winning symbols explode and new ones drop, letting you to chain multiple wins from one spin.
What triggers the Free Falls bonus round?
Get four or more golden Free Fall scatter symbols anywhere on the reels in one spin. This awards you a set number of free spins. During this round, a multiplier begins and increases with every winning cascade you trigger.
